Alabama Rep. Barry Moore Fights for Farmers' Rights on Capitol Hill
Barry Moore, a Republican from Alabama, has been serving on the Agriculture Committee in Congress. He's dedicated to finding solutions for the state's farmers, guided by his upbringing on a family farm and his education in poultry science.
Moore, who describes himself as a 'proud MAGA conservative', grew up in Coffee County, Alabama, and studied poultry science at Auburn University. His experience working with farmers to deliver products for their operations has shaped his legislative efforts. Moore believes farming is about providing for America, being good stewards of the land, and preserving traditions for future generations.
Moore's work on the Agriculture Committee is driven by the principle of giving Alabama farmers the tools and freedom to thrive. Recently, he opposed changes to the Adverse Effective Wage Rate (AEWR) methodology for H-2A agricultural workers, proposed by the Biden Administration.
